Transaction 641ef81c13dfe025e15e56d0c921f3e0cea27257fad7b093726150b0901ee50e

1 Input
2 Outputs
  • 641ef81c13dfe025e15e56d0c921f3e0cea27257fad7b093726150b0901ee50e:0
  • value  17511514
    address  1FHN4rAud4WqtafHSHpoeXwbEVTNhAuGbZ
  • 641ef81c13dfe025e15e56d0c921f3e0cea27257fad7b093726150b0901ee50e:1
  • value  1326939
    address  3EcUUN4iuWWZan8yHvpjtUv4eoBqJjBvRs